Subject: [FreeVMS] Re: First compilation
From: BERTRAND JoŽl (email@example.com)
Date: Thu Nov 22 2001 - 11:10:31 CET
> On Wed, Nov 21, 2001 at 04:24:40PM +0100, BERTRAND JoŽl wrote:
>>>On Wed, Nov 21, 2001 at 02:32:48PM +0100, BERTRAND JoŽl wrote:
>>>Keeping a Linux CVS-tree is really the Linux-developers' business.
>>>(For instance, the NSA SELinux stuff is patches to existing Linux kernels)
>>>We might be mainly Linux-kernel based for years, and it would be good to
>>>have the possibility of keeping up with the current kernels.
>>>I am still figuring out how minimalize manual intervention when patching
>>>to newer kernels. (Had already had to patch manually)
>> Yes, but we shall add some sources to the official Linux kernel. The
>>NSA-Linux ę is Ľ a Linux kernel... I think that these patches will be
>>bigger, and I'm not sure that it will be easy to patch a kernel 2.4.x+1
>>by the patch written for the 2.4.x.
> The new (VMS) stuff will be placed in freevms/sys/src etc.
> (Where it really belongs)
> Something is there already, and I plan to move some of my changes there soon.
> I will try structure the stuff in freevms/linux so that it may easily be
> patched with patches from ftp.kernel.org.
You don't forget that some include and sources files are changed between
two releases of the Linux kernel. So, we have only two solutions :
1/ choice a Linux kernel, cut off its tree and patch this tree with
certain Linux kernel patches ;
2/ make FreeVMS as a Linux kernel patch, but we shall modify our patches
for each new Linux kernel.
For me, the better choice is the first. But if you can show that it's really
the worst choice...
To successfull compile the kernel, I have added
void *journal_info; to the task_struct defined in sched.h. This field is
needed by the journalized support (2.4.15pre2).
Nobody can say if the Shark logo is registered, but if it registered,
it's by Compaq. So, I will propose a logo (80*80) soon.
-- Liste de diffusion FreeVMS Pour se dťsinscrire : mailto:firstname.lastname@example.org?subject=unsubscribe
This archive was generated by hypermail 2b25 : Thu Nov 22 2001 - 11:10:06 CET